This hurts all of us. While it looks nice and white out there conditions are still very poor around here. I just got back into Frederic about noon after driving home from Traverse City. The trailhead parking lot out by Dingmans 12 miles west of grayling had 1 truck and trailer there and 2 sleds sitting there running. While the snow is a bit thicker out that way and up towards starvation lake its still very marginal riding and the weather forcast isn’t making us feel any better with rain and 40s this weekend. So I guess I just have to be Debbie Downer and wait for something to happen and cheer all of us up. Sunday night I decided it was dead here so we took off and went to Denver and there was only a few inches of snow on the ground there and the day before it had been 50. Chicago this morning looked like much more rideable snow than here too along with Kalamazoo. That is where there is rideable snow just west of kalmazoo on the Kal Haven trail. My brother has been out there riding on that quite a few times already this season and the picture below was taken yesterday near south haven. So its kind of backwards that the good snow is all very south right now. Areas north  to the bridge are all pretty much in the same shape but I believe Petoskey still might have some of their 20 inch storm left.
